
Mabel Julienne Scott
From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ia Mabel Julienne Scott (November 2, 1892 – October 1, 1976) was an American stage and silent movie actress. Her feature film debut came in The Lash of Destiny (1916). She was contracted to George Medford Productions, but made motion pictures for both Famous Players and Goldwyn Pictures.
